On Feb 13, 2007, at 8:26 AM, Kent Swafford wrote:

> I wasn't tempted by the original Fujan aluminum lever, but the new  
> model with the carbon-fiber tube is a much improved beast. The  
> diameter of the carbon-fiber tube is somewhat smaller than the  
> aluminum, and note the new smooth, flush shape where the ball meets  
> the tube. Add the new 20 degree head and an old Hale tip and this  
> thing performs beautifully.
>
> The photo shows a new Fujan with a Faulk titanium lever, both with  
> 20 degree heads and Hale tips. I still use the Faulk as well, but  
> the longer Fujan has greater leverage, is probably stiffer, _and_  
> it weighs less than the Faulk. The Faulk weighs 9.3 oz. and the  
> Fujan weighs 8.6 oz.
